<p><strong>2024-25 TEAM PREVIEW: BELEN EAGLES</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>OVERVIEW</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>After finishing 9-18 and missing the Class 4A playoffs last season, Belen loses its top scorer (Jordi Rojo) but otherwise returns most of its major contributors, including a pair of Second Team All-District performers, and some promising new talent for 2024-25.</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>“Last year we didn't have much size, and we still won't have much size, but I think this offseason we've gotten much better in learning how to play small ball,” Belen head coach Donald Marquez told Prep Redzone New Mexico. “We're attacking the boards a lot more and looking to push the ball up when we get the rebound. We know bigger teams will try to pound the ball inside on us.”</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Marquez, who enters his fourth season as head coach of the Eagles, says he noticed the steady improvement in his team from the beginning of summer to the end.</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>“At the beginning of June, we were losing a lot but by the end of June we were winning a lot more,” Marquez said. “I saw the improvement. We're playing real good team ball. The program is starting to develop into what I want it to be.” </p>

<p><strong>PLAYERS TO WATCH</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1913990' first='Damian' last='Avila'] (G, Sr., 5-9 )</strong>: Avila was Belen's second leading scorer last season (13.1 ppg) and second leading rebounder. Second-Team All-District. Should see most of his action at small forward and out on the wing. Very good defender. Brings toughness. Better in utilizing his speed to attack the basket.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1687824' first='Jasode' last='Harris'] (G, Sr., 5-8)</strong>: Another Second-Team All-District performer after averaging 11.3 points and 3.1 rpg in 2023-24. He made 41 3-pointers.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1695752' first='Alan' last='Moreno'] (G, Sr., 5-10)</strong>: Returning starter who will likely share point guard duties. Averaged 6.3 points and 2.5 rpg in 2023-24.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>Josiah Navarro (F, Sr., 6-0)</strong>: Averaged 5.1 points and 2.8 rebounds per game in 2023-24. Good shooter. Very quick. “He has really stepped up his game,” Marquez said. “He looks very good. He is very fast and plays great defense. I haven't seen many players as fast as him. He is great in anticipating passes on defense.”</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='2300010' first='Samuel' last='Sanchez'] (F, Jr. 6-3)</strong>: Sanchez brings size to the front court and a willingness to battle for rebounds. He averaged 6.0 rebounds per game in 2023-24. “Samuel has gotten a lot stronger,” Marquez said. “He's a good rebounder. He's adding a good post-game inside. We've been hitting the weight room more. We should be faster and stronger.”</p>

<p><strong>FINAL THOUGHTS</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Belen will have a good mixture of seniors, juniors and sophomores on the roster this season after being junior-heavy in 2023-24.</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>“It's going to be nice because all our guys can play and they can score,” Marquez said. “We're going to play better team ball and our scoring will be distributed better rather than just relying on one guy. We could be nine or 10 deep and I like that. We won't have the same five or six guys playing the whole game. We're going to get out and run. When we substitute, we won't lose much with the guys coming off the bench.” </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Belen will compete in District 4A-5 with Grants, Highland, St. Pius X and Valencia.</p>
